Matches in SemOpenAlex for { <https://semopenalex.org/work/W1483501515> ?p ?o ?g. }
- W1483501515 endingPage "25" @default.
- W1483501515 startingPage "1" @default.
- W1483501515 abstract "Aspect oriented programming aims at achieving better modularization for a system's crosscutting concerns in order to improve its key quality attributes, such as evolvability and reusability. Consequently, the adoption of aspect-oriented techniques in existing (legacy) software systems is of interest to remediate software aging. The refactoring of existing systems to employ aspect-orientation will be considerably eased by a systematic approach that will ensure a safe and consistent migration. In this paper, we propose a refactoring and testing strategy that supports such an approach and consider issues of behavior conservation and (incremental) integration of the aspect-oriented solution with the original system. The strategy is applied to the JHotDraw open source project and illustrated on a group of selected concerns. Finally, we abstract from the case study and present a number of generic refactorings which contribute to an incremental aspect-oriented refactoring process and associate particular types of crosscutting concerns to the model and features of the employed aspect language. The contributions of this paper are both in the area of supporting migration towards aspect-oriented solutions and supporting the development of aspect languages that are better suited for such migrations" @default.
- W1483501515 created "2016-06-24" @default.
- W1483501515 creator A5031139191 @default.
- W1483501515 creator A5056189345 @default.
- W1483501515 creator A5090401584 @default.
- W1483501515 date "2005-01-01" @default.
- W1483501515 modified "2023-09-26" @default.
- W1483501515 title "A systematic aspect-oriented refactoring and testing strategy, and its application to JHotDraw." @default.
- W1483501515 cites W1498770298 @default.
- W1483501515 cites W1532926224 @default.
- W1483501515 cites W1543310791 @default.
- W1483501515 cites W1573866550 @default.
- W1483501515 cites W1596127723 @default.
- W1483501515 cites W1649645444 @default.
- W1483501515 cites W1689913591 @default.
- W1483501515 cites W1978966756 @default.
- W1483501515 cites W1985236007 @default.
- W1483501515 cites W1988978715 @default.
- W1483501515 cites W1990991680 @default.
- W1483501515 cites W1995008247 @default.
- W1483501515 cites W2027106228 @default.
- W1483501515 cites W2045352263 @default.
- W1483501515 cites W2045749853 @default.
- W1483501515 cites W2067057008 @default.
- W1483501515 cites W2097964082 @default.
- W1483501515 cites W2106020683 @default.
- W1483501515 cites W2116243202 @default.
- W1483501515 cites W2124176833 @default.
- W1483501515 cites W2136531538 @default.
- W1483501515 cites W2142630726 @default.
- W1483501515 cites W2149612550 @default.
- W1483501515 cites W2153887189 @default.
- W1483501515 cites W2158024764 @default.
- W1483501515 cites W2161825580 @default.
- W1483501515 cites W2253448825 @default.
- W1483501515 cites W2294305189 @default.
- W1483501515 cites W36116712 @default.
- W1483501515 cites W137613689 @default.
- W1483501515 cites W79369379 @default.
- W1483501515 hasPublicationYear "2005" @default.
- W1483501515 type Work @default.
- W1483501515 sameAs 1483501515 @default.
- W1483501515 citedByCount "14" @default.
- W1483501515 countsByYear W14835015152013 @default.
- W1483501515 countsByYear W14835015152015 @default.
- W1483501515 crossrefType "journal-article" @default.
- W1483501515 hasAuthorship W1483501515A5031139191 @default.
- W1483501515 hasAuthorship W1483501515A5056189345 @default.
- W1483501515 hasAuthorship W1483501515A5090401584 @default.
- W1483501515 hasConcept C105446022 @default.
- W1483501515 hasConcept C115903868 @default.
- W1483501515 hasConcept C137981799 @default.
- W1483501515 hasConcept C152752567 @default.
- W1483501515 hasConcept C176147130 @default.
- W1483501515 hasConcept C199360897 @default.
- W1483501515 hasConcept C2777904410 @default.
- W1483501515 hasConcept C2779478453 @default.
- W1483501515 hasConcept C41008148 @default.
- W1483501515 hasConcept C54355233 @default.
- W1483501515 hasConcept C60051680 @default.
- W1483501515 hasConcept C76214141 @default.
- W1483501515 hasConcept C78458016 @default.
- W1483501515 hasConcept C86803240 @default.
- W1483501515 hasConcept C88482812 @default.
- W1483501515 hasConcept C98045186 @default.
- W1483501515 hasConceptScore W1483501515C105446022 @default.
- W1483501515 hasConceptScore W1483501515C115903868 @default.
- W1483501515 hasConceptScore W1483501515C137981799 @default.
- W1483501515 hasConceptScore W1483501515C152752567 @default.
- W1483501515 hasConceptScore W1483501515C176147130 @default.
- W1483501515 hasConceptScore W1483501515C199360897 @default.
- W1483501515 hasConceptScore W1483501515C2777904410 @default.
- W1483501515 hasConceptScore W1483501515C2779478453 @default.
- W1483501515 hasConceptScore W1483501515C41008148 @default.
- W1483501515 hasConceptScore W1483501515C54355233 @default.
- W1483501515 hasConceptScore W1483501515C60051680 @default.
- W1483501515 hasConceptScore W1483501515C76214141 @default.
- W1483501515 hasConceptScore W1483501515C78458016 @default.
- W1483501515 hasConceptScore W1483501515C86803240 @default.
- W1483501515 hasConceptScore W1483501515C88482812 @default.
- W1483501515 hasConceptScore W1483501515C98045186 @default.
- W1483501515 hasIssue "07" @default.
- W1483501515 hasLocation W14835015151 @default.
- W1483501515 hasOpenAccess W1483501515 @default.
- W1483501515 hasPrimaryLocation W14835015151 @default.
- W1483501515 hasRelatedWork W144850808 @default.
- W1483501515 hasRelatedWork W1573866550 @default.
- W1483501515 hasRelatedWork W1581666920 @default.
- W1483501515 hasRelatedWork W1596127723 @default.
- W1483501515 hasRelatedWork W1610570299 @default.
- W1483501515 hasRelatedWork W1972328554 @default.
- W1483501515 hasRelatedWork W1982596275 @default.
- W1483501515 hasRelatedWork W2017846650 @default.
- W1483501515 hasRelatedWork W2029414465 @default.
- W1483501515 hasRelatedWork W2031913690 @default.
- W1483501515 hasRelatedWork W2041859725 @default.
- W1483501515 hasRelatedWork W2049695835 @default.
- W1483501515 hasRelatedWork W2097964082 @default.